finger

a simple finger client
Log | Files | Refs

commit ea732482a4e92f463b89bbbd2215c12d67f3547f
parent f19055b6e9735d304e20629955e65833df1a8699
Author: Naveen Narayanan <zerous@nocebo.space>
Date:   Sat, 25 Sep 2021 18:19:43 +0200

Localize buffer

Diffstat:
Mfinger.c | 6+++---
1 file changed, 3 insertions(+), 3 deletions(-)

diff --git a/finger.c b/finger.c @@ -12,7 +12,6 @@ #include <unistd.h> #define BUFSZ 128 -char buf[BUFSZ]; void usage(void) @@ -51,11 +50,12 @@ main(int argc, char **argv) { struct addrinfo hints = { 0 }; struct addrinfo *res, *p; - char user[32], hostname[MAXHOSTNAMELEN+1]; - char *msg = buf; + char buf[BUFSZ], hostname[MAXHOSTNAMELEN+1], user[32]; + char *msg; int status, sockfd, byt, len, err, tosend; err = 0; + msg = buf; if (argc != 2) usage();